It should be possible to configure SSL termination
Bug #1418503 reported by
Free Ekanayaka
This bug affects 1 person
Affects | Status | Importance | Assigned to | Milestone | |
---|---|---|---|---|---|
haproxy (Juju Charms Collection) |
New
|
Undecided
|
Unassigned |
Bug Description
SSL termination is supported by HAProxy 1.5, which is installable via the "source" configuration key introduced by:
The charm should offer a way to specify a certificate or generate a self-signed one.
Related branches
lp:~free.ekanayaka/charms/trusty/haproxy/ssl-crt-support
- Chris Glass (community): Approve
- Review Queue (community): Needs Fixing (automated testing)
-
Diff: 4000 lines (+2735/-212)29 files modifiedREADME.md (+28/-0)
config-manager.txt (+1/-1)
config.yaml (+25/-0)
data/openssl.cnf (+21/-0)
hooks/charmhelpers/__init__.py (+38/-0)
hooks/charmhelpers/contrib/__init__.py (+15/-0)
hooks/charmhelpers/contrib/charmsupport/__init__.py (+15/-0)
hooks/charmhelpers/contrib/charmsupport/nrpe.py (+116/-10)
hooks/charmhelpers/contrib/charmsupport/volumes.py (+21/-2)
hooks/charmhelpers/core/__init__.py (+15/-0)
hooks/charmhelpers/core/decorators.py (+57/-0)
hooks/charmhelpers/core/fstab.py (+134/-0)
hooks/charmhelpers/core/hookenv.py (+269/-41)
hooks/charmhelpers/core/host.py (+254/-47)
hooks/charmhelpers/core/services/__init__.py (+18/-0)
hooks/charmhelpers/core/services/base.py (+329/-0)
hooks/charmhelpers/core/services/helpers.py (+259/-0)
hooks/charmhelpers/core/sysctl.py (+56/-0)
hooks/charmhelpers/core/templating.py (+68/-0)
hooks/charmhelpers/fetch/__init__.py (+309/-79)
hooks/charmhelpers/fetch/archiveurl.py (+121/-8)
hooks/charmhelpers/fetch/bzrurl.py (+39/-5)
hooks/charmhelpers/fetch/giturl.py (+71/-0)
hooks/hooks.py (+216/-14)
hooks/tests/test_config_changed_hooks.py (+28/-0)
hooks/tests/test_helpers.py (+87/-2)
hooks/tests/test_install.py (+21/-2)
hooks/tests/test_peer_hooks.py (+59/-1)
tests/10_deploy_test.py (+45/-0)
To post a comment you must log in.